What is the electronic signature legitimateness for job applicant rejection letter in Australia
The electronic signature legitimateness for a job applicant rejection letter in Australia refers to the legal acceptance of eSignatures in formal correspondence regarding employment decisions. In Australia, electronic signatures are recognized under the Electronic Transactions Act 1999, which provides that a signature is valid if it is made in a way that identifies the person and indicates their intention to sign. This means that employers can use electronic signatures to finalize rejection letters, ensuring a streamlined and efficient process.

Legal use of the electronic signature legitimateness for job applicant rejection letter in Australia
The legal use of electronic signatures in job applicant rejection letters aligns with Australian laws that recognize the validity of eSignatures in business transactions. Employers must ensure that the electronic signature process complies with the Electronic Transactions Act, which mandates that the signature must be reliable and appropriately linked to the signer. By following these guidelines, employers can ensure that their rejection letters hold legal weight and are enforceable in case of disputes.
Security & Compliance Guidelines
When using electronic signatures for job applicant rejection letters, it is essential to adhere to security and compliance guidelines. Employers should ensure that the eSignature platform, such as airSlate SignNow, employs robust encryption methods to protect sensitive information. Additionally, maintaining a clear audit trail of the signing process is crucial for compliance purposes. This includes tracking when the document was sent, viewed, and signed, as well as retaining copies of the signed documents for record-keeping.
